Water leak detection services involve identifying the source of hidden leaks within a property’s plumbing or infrastructure. These services typically use specialized tools and techniques such as electronic leak detection, thermal imaging, and acoustic sensors to locate leaks that are not immediately visible. By pinpointing the exact location of a leak, homeowners can avoid unnecessary damage and reduce the costs associated with extensive repairs. Professional leak detection helps ensure that leaks are addressed promptly before they cause significant issues, such as structural damage or mold growth.
This service is essential in solving problems related to unexplained increases in water bills, damp spots on walls or ceilings, and the presence of mold or mildew. Leaks that go unnoticed can lead to water damage, wood rot, and even compromised foundation stability over time. Water leak detection services help prevent these issues by catching leaks early, allowing homeowners to take targeted action. Detecting leaks quickly also minimizes water waste and can prevent costly repairs that might be needed if the problem is left unresolved.

The overview below groups typical Water Leak Detection proj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- for minor leaks or localized issues,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ering simple detection and patching work.
Moderate Leak Detection - more involved projects, such as locating leaks behind walls or under floors, us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These jobs are common and often require specialized equipment.
Pipe Replacement - replacing sections of damaged piping can range from $1,500 to $3,500 depending on the extent of the work. Larger projects of this type are less frequent but necessary for significant leaks.
Full System Replacement - comprehensive water leak detection and pipe replacement can reach $5,000 or more for extensive or complex jobs. These are typically larger, more complex projects that involve significant labor and materials.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How do water leak detection services work? Local contractors typically use specialized equipment to identify the source of leaks within walls, floors, or underground plumbing, helping to locate leaks accurately without unnecessary damage.
What signs indicate a possible water leak? Common signs include unexplained increases in water bills, damp spots or mold growth, persistent musty odors, or the sound of running water when fixtures are off.
Can water leak detection prevent major property damage? Yes, early detection by experienced service providers can help identify leaks before they cause significant structural damage or mold growth.
Are water leak detection services invasive? Many methods are minimally invasive, using non-destructive techniques such as acoustic sensors or thermal imaging to locate leaks without extensive demolition.
